Amen » Used in prayer
Then Benaiah, the son of Jehoiada, answered the king and said, Amen. Let the LORD God of my lord the king say so too.
Blessed be the LORD God of Israel from eternity unto eternity. And all the people said, Amen and praised the LORD.
and Ezra blessed the LORD, the great God. And all the people answered, Amen, Amen, lifting up their hands; and they humbled themselves and worshipped the LORD with their faces to the ground.
Blessed be the LORD God of Israel from everlasting and to everlasting. Amen, and Amen.
And blessed be his glorious name for ever, and let the whole earth be filled with his glory; Amen, and Amen.
Blessed be the LORD God of Israel from everlasting to everlasting; and let all the people say, Amen. Halelu-JAH.
therefore the prophet Jeremiah said, Amen: the LORD do so: the LORD confirm thy words with which thou hast prophesied that the vessels of the LORD's house and all those that are carried away captive are to be returned from Babylon unto this place.
And lead us not into temptation, but deliver us from evil, for thine is the kingdom and the power and the glory forever. Amen.
Else when thou shalt bless with the spirit, how shall he that occupies the place of the ignorant say, Amen, at thy giving of thanks, seeing he understands not what thou sayest?
